Bevo has $5000 to invest. Bank A offers a savings account that has an APR of 1.15% and compounds monthly. Which equation will determine how much money Bevo will have in his account after 9 years?

Answers

Answer 1

The equation [tex]A=5000(1.000958333)^{108}[/tex] will determine how much money Bevo will have in his account after 9 years

Step-by-step explanation:

The formula for compound interest, including principal sum is

[tex]A=P(1+\frac{r}{n})^{nt}[/tex] , where:

A is the future value of the investment/loan, including interestP is the principal investment amount (the initial deposit or loan amount)r is the annual interest rate (decimal)n is the number of times that interest is compounded per unit tt is the time the money is invested or borrowed for

Bevo has $5000 to invest. Bank A offers a savings account that has an APR of 1.15% and compounds monthly

We need to find Which equation will determine how much money Bevo will have in his account after 9 years

Because there is no choices we will write the equation

∵ Bevo has $5000 to invest

∴ P = 5000

∵ Bank A offers a savings account that has an APR of 1.15%

   and compounds monthly

∴ r = 1.15% = 1.15 ÷ 100 = 0.0115

∴ n = 12 ⇒ compounds monthly

∵ t = 9

- Substitute all of theses values in the formula below

∵ [tex]A=P(1+\frac{r}{n})^{nt}[/tex]

∴ [tex]A=5000(1+\frac{0.0115}{12})^{(12)(9)}[/tex]

∴ [tex]A=5000(1.000958333)^{108}[/tex]

The equation [tex]A=5000(1.000958333)^{108}[/tex] will determine how much money Bevo will have in his account after 9 years

What is a function?

A relation is a function if it has only One y-value for each x-value.

The original function is f(x)=√x

As this is condition for √x function, x≥ 0

Domain= [0, infinity)

Range= [0, infinity)

After the reflection across x-axis and y-axis, we get a function,

g(x)=-√-x

-x≥ 0 means x≤ 0,

So,

Domain= (-infinity, 0]

Range= (-infinity, 0]

From this you can see that the only value that is in the domains of both functions is 0.

The range of g(x) is all values less than or equal to 0.

Hence,  the only value that is in the domains of both functions is 0.

and the range of g(x) is all values less than or equal to 0 are correct.
